Lightsworn Dragonling

Opis

If you have a "Lightsworn" monster in your GY: You can Special Summon this card from your hand. If this card is Special Summoned: You can send 1 "Lightsworn" card from your Deck to the GY, except "Lightsworn Dragonling". If this card is sent to the GY: You can add 1 Dragon monster with 3000 ATK/2600 DEF from your Deck to your hand. You can only use each effect of "Lightsworn Dragonling" once per turn.
